Portsmouth school signs up to learn first aid and CPR
Gosport-based firm Mum Aid, First Aid is working with Portsmouth City Council to give pupils the chance to learn the vital, potentially life-saving techniques.
The first school to sign up was Portsmouth Academy For Girls, in Fratton.
